MLK .. Honored or Slightly Pissed Off ?

WASHINGTON — The centerpiece for the Martin Luther King Jr. memorial on the National Mall has drawn criticism from a federal arts panel, which says the proposed statue looks “confrontational” and resembles the head of a socialist state more than a civil rights leader.

Models of the 28-foot tall statue depict King emerging from a chunk of granite, his arms folded in front of his chest, his legs firmly rooted, an intense gaze on his face.

But the U.S. Commission of Fine Arts, which reviews the design of projects in the capital area, said the design should be reworked to reflect a more sympathetic rendering of King.  Full Story .

Hyundai … did you say Hyundai ?

Hyundai is not messing around with the Hyundai Genesis. The Korean automaker has set its sights on one of the most prestigious segments extant, the premium sports sedan. Doing a couple of the Japanese contenders better, Hyundai is dropping into the fray swinging, with a rear-wheel-drive platform and a choice of three engines, starting with a 264-hp V-6 and topping out with a 368-hp V-8 attached to a six-speed ZF automatic — and a price tag under $40,000. It’ll feature hot bits such as adaptive everything, a premium interior, eight airbags, and even an optional backup camera. And the Genesis really does look the part, if only because it’s a visual mash-up of every other successful car in the segment.  Full Article.
